STUDENTS WITH DISABILITIES:
The institution offers 100% scholarships in tuition fee for all disable enrolled. We are also trying their additional needs, including special examination arrangements, one to one learning support, help in other scholarships. We have a strong relation with media and other national and international organizations working for disable people.
The disabilities support scholarship is available in unlimited numbers by the institution.
Disabilities Support can also support people who have a temporary difficulty which impairs their mobility or dexterity. This may be as a result of an accident, injury, illness or surgery.
Every person is treated as an individual, and we invite you to contact us as early as possible so that we can consider your needs and tailor our support to meet them.
The Institute is committed to admitting and supporting students with disabilities and welcomes applications from them.
We provide support for students with a range of conditions which have a long-term and adverse effect on studying, including:
• sensory (visual / hearing / speech) impairments
• mental health issues
• mobility impairments
• dexterity impairments
• physical disabilities
• Asperger's Syndrome or other autistic spectrum disorders
• chronic medical conditions (e.g. diabetes, epilepsy, H.I.V.)
• chronic pain / chronic fatigue
• specific learning difficulties (e.g. dyslexia, dyspraxia) The disabilities support scholarship is available in unlimited numbers by the institution.
